Taxes can be confusing, but they don't have to be. With a slew of numbers, acronyms and deadlines, it can be ...The Meaning of IRS Code 826 on a Tax Account Transcript. Understanding what IRS Code 826 might mean on a tax account transcript isn't difficult. This TC indicates that the IRS used a tax refund to settle a tax debt. The code also reveals if the tax debt was accrued during the current or previous tax years. Learn how the average refund amount has increased despite a decrease in total refunds issued, and grasp the implications of various IRS transcript codes, such as 570 and 971, on your refund process.IRS Code 898 will appear near the bottom of this document if the BFS offsets your refund and uses the funds to pay an outstanding court-ordered, federal, or state debt. You'll see Code 899 on your tax account transcript if the BFS determines you should receive the refund and that TOP was initiated by mistake. Got codes on 2020 return-just filed end of 2021. Lis Jan 28, 2018 · If you have a 570 code there is a good chance you may receive a letter explaining any adjustments to your account. If you have a 570 code on your account transcript you will need to wait for a 571 or 572 resolved additional account action code to post which will reverse the 570 code before you would see an 846 Refund issued code.Oct 6, 2021 · New Tax Transcript Format and Utilizing a Customer File Number.
